1. Embrace a Nutrient-Rich Diet
The foundation of any healthy lifestyle starts with nutrition. Eating a well-balanced diet filled with whole foods, f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y fats provides your body with the essential vitamins and minerals it needs to thrive. These nutrients fuel your energy levels, support your immune system, and keep your mind sharp. Additionally, drinking plenty of water throughout the day helps maintain hydration, supports digestion, and keeps your skin looking radiant.
Tip: Try to incorporate more plant-based meals into your diet, as they are rich in fiber, antioxidants, and essential nutrients. Eating a variety of colorful foods ensures that you’re covering all your nutritional bases.

2. Prioritize Regular Physical Activity
Exercise is not just about getting fit; it’s an important part of mental wellness, too. Regular physical activity helps reduce stress, improve mood, and enhance sleep quality. Whether you prefer high-intensity workouts, yoga, or simply going for a walk, moving your body releases endorphins, which are natural mood boosters. Plus, staying active strengthens your heart, bones, and muscles, helping you feel more energized throughout the day.
Tip: Find a workout routine that you enjoy. If you love what you’re doing, you’re more likely to stick with it. Mix up your workouts to prevent boredom and challenge different muscle groups.
4. Manage Stress Effectively
In today’s fast-paced world, stress is almost unavoidable, but how you manage it can make all the difference. Chronic stress can negatively impact your health, causing anxiety, poor sleep, and even physical illness. Finding ways to manage stress is essential for maintaining balance in your life.
Practices like meditation, deep breathing, and mindfulness can help lower stress levels and improve your overall well-being. Taking time each day to relax, whether through reading, journaling, or enjoying a hobby, can also provide you with much-needed mental clarity.
Tip: Set aside a few minutes every day to practice mindfulness or relaxation techniques. This can help you regain focus, calm your mind, and improve your emotional health.
5. Sleep: The Foundation of Wellness
Good quality sleep is often overlooked when it comes to health, but it’s a crucial part of maintaining balance. Sleep allows your body to rest, recover, and rejuvenate, giving you the energy you need to face the day ahead. Lack of sleep can affect everything from cognitive function to emotional regulation, so it’s important to prioritize rest.
Tip: Establish a sleep routine by going to bed and waking up at the same time each day. Creating a calming bedtime ritual, such or practicing relaxation techniques, can also help signal to your body that it’s time to wind down.
6. Cultivate Healthy Habits for Mental Wellness
Physical health is important, but so is mental well-being. Taking care of your mind can help you handle stress better, improve your mood, and increase your overall quality of life. Engage in activities that make you feel good and help you stay mentally sharp. This might include reading, solving puzzles, learning a new skill, or simply spending time with loved ones.
Additionally, the importance of social connections cannot be overstated. Building meaningful relationships can provide emotional support, enhance your sense of belonging, and positively impact your mental health.
Tip: Practice gratitude daily by acknowledging the things you’re thankful for. This can help shift your mindset toward positivity and improve emotional resilience.
7. Stay Consistent with Small, Positive Changes
Revitalizing your health doesn’t require drastic changes overnight. It’s about making small, sustainable adjustments that lead to lasting improvements. Start by setting realistic goals, whether it’s incorporating more fruits and vegetables into your diet or committing to a 10-minute daily workout. Consistency is key when it comes to building healthy habits.
Tip: Keep track of your progress and celebrate small victories along the way. This helps build momentum and keeps you motivated as you work toward a healthier, balanced lifestyle.
